Music is a vehicle of personal expression and creativity, and it plays an important part in the development of children.
Experiencing the joy of performing and creating music in groups is at the core of our Music teaching ethos. Pupils have the opportunity to learn instruments in class, ranging from keyboards to djembe drums and ukuleles as well as having 1:1 lessons with our large team of visiting music teachers on instruments such as the saxophone.
Music promotes emotional wellbeing, offering an outlet for self-expression and creativity.









It encourages collaboration, teamwork, and discipline through group performances and practice. This is a subject that all our pupils feel happy and comfortable in, enjoying the extensive resources we have at TPS.

Drama
At the heart of TPS drama is our commitment to support children’s creative and communicative growth as well as to help them discovery their sense of individuality and inner confidence.
We believe in non-judgemental and inspiring rehearsal spaces where pupils can use their imagination to help develop their vocal, physical and storytelling skills through both improvisation and scripted activities.
Working individually, in small groups or with larger casts for production work, children are encouraged to find joy in both the collaborative process as well as a feeling of accomplishment in performing in front of an audience.
We also support pupils’ understanding and appreciation of technical aspects of theatre, including sound, lighting and digital media.
